Best time to go to Cedar Grove

The best time to visit Cedar Grove can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Cedar Grove falls in July, when visitor numbers are high and weather is s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Cedar Grove fal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January24.6°F (-4.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
February23.4°F (-4.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March26.2°F (-3.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April32.9°F (0.5°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
May40.1°F (4.5°C)Light RainSunnyHighSlightly High
June52.0°F (11.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yHighAverage
July59.4°F (15.2°C)Light RainSunnyHighSlightly High
August57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September52.5°F (11.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
October42.3°F (5.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
November31.6°F (-0.2°C)Light RainSunnyLowSlightly Low
December24.4°F (-4.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Cedar Grove

For your trip to Cedar Grove, California, consider flying into three major airports. Fresno Yosemite International Airport (FAT) is 58 miles away, offering nearby hotels like the 4-star DoubleTree by Hilton Fresno Convention Center, 4 miles from the airport, and the 3-star Piccadilly Inn Airport, just 0.3 miles away. Eastern Sierra Regional Airport (BIH) is 43 miles from Cedar Grove, with options like the 3.5-star Wayfinder Bishop and Vagabond Inn, both 2 miles away. Lastly, Visalia Municipal Airport (VIS) is 52 miles away, featuring the 3.5-star Visalia Marriott at the Convention Center, 6 miles away, and the Wyndham Visalia, only 0.4 miles from the airport.
